Precisely what is a Groin Muscle mass Strain?
A groin strain occurs once the muscles while in the internal thigh or groin space are overstretched or torn. These muscles, referred to as the adductors, aid stabilize the leg and Handle movement towards the human body. Prevalent results in include unexpected variations in way, overuse, or rigorous Bodily action. Indicators normally contain sharp ache inside the inner thigh or groin, swelling, bruising, and difficulty going for walks or undertaking athletic movements. Most groin strains are mild to average and may be handled with relaxation, ice, compression, and targeted Actual physical therapy exercises.
What is a Sporting activities Hernia?
A athletics hernia, generally known as athletic pubalgia, is just not a traditional hernia but a tender tissue harm on the reduce abdominal wall or maybe the muscles on the groin. It usually takes place in athletes who complete repetitive twisting and turning motions, including soccer, hockey, or soccer players. Compared with an average groin pressure, a sports activities hernia may well not result in obvious swelling or possibly a bulge. Signs and symptoms normally contain deep groin or lower abdominal soreness, pain that worsens with action, and soreness in the course of unexpected actions like kicking or sprinting. Because it can mimic other injuries, athletics hernias are often misdiagnosed as groin strains or adductor injuries.
Sports activities Hernia vs Groin Pressure
Differentiating a sporting activities hernia from the groin pressure may be demanding. Though the two lead to agony within the groin spot, athletics hernias ordinarily involve the reduced abdominal muscles and will current with soreness all through unexpected twisting or lateral actions. Groin strains, Conversely, contain the adductor muscles and are usually connected with tenderness, swelling, and constrained variety of motion inside the inner thigh.
Other circumstances may also mimic these injuries, such as abdominal strains or general pulled muscles. Proper analysis generally involves a combination of physical assessment, imaging scientific tests like MRI, and an evaluation in the athlete’s history.
Treatment Solutions
Cure for the groin strain ordinarily requires groin strain vs sports hernia conservative techniques which include rest, ice, compression, elevation (RICE), and Actual physical therapy. Strengthening physical exercises for your adductor muscles and gradual return to Activity are necessary to prevent recurrence.
Sports activities hernias, having said that, could require additional intensive management. Conservative care with physical therapy and anti-inflammatory drugs might help, but persistent scenarios frequently will need surgical intervention to restore the weakened tissue. Article-surgical rehabilitation focuses on restoring power, balance, and suppleness in both of those the groin and reduce abdominal muscles.
